Abstract

The invention relates to a photovoltaic device (10) for the direct conversion of radiation energy into electric energy, having at least one solar cell (20), having at least one first optical element (40) for focusing the incident radiation, and having at least one second optical element (70, 75) for deflecting the focused radiation in the direction of the solar cell (20), wherein at least one holding device (80) is provided, which positions the second optical element (70, 75) relative to the first optical element (40) and relative to the solar cell (20), wherein the solar cell (20) is hermetically sealed in a hollow space (90), and wherein the hollow space (90) is delimited at least by the holding device (80) and the second optical element (70, 75). The invention further relates to a solar system having a plurality of such photovoltaic devices (10), and to a method for the production of the photovoltaic device (10).
